FoxPro/Visual FoxPro - Relacion entre tablas

 
Vista:

Relacion entre tablas

Publicado por Javier (43 intervenciones) el 18/09/2006 22:05:50
Buenas tardes.
Necesitaría que me ayuden con lo siguiente:
Tengo un formulario que en el entorno de datos agregue 2 tablas.
Las mismas están relacionadas por un campo en común.
Cuando me posiciono en un registro de la primer tabla me muestra el registro relacionado en la segunda tabla.
Pero tengo un problema. En el caso de que la primer tabla esté vacía como tengo que hacer para que no me muestre ningún registro de la segunda tabla. Es posible hacerlo con el entorno de datos?
Los datos los estoy mostrando con la propiedad ControlSource de campos de texto.

Desde ya muchas gracias.

Javier
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Relacion entre tablas

Publicado por juan (537 intervenciones) el 18/09/2006 23:16:00
Puede usar el datenvironment ..pero si agregas esto en el Init
de tú form ,botón o cuadro de lista ..es más práctico usar código

Mira hací
supongamos que ya tenemos abierta las 2 tablas con el Dataenv..
Sele clientes
Index On codigo to cod_1

Sele Recepcio
Index On codigo to cod_2
Set Filter to codigo<>" " && Filtra las segunda tabla para los
&& codigos que sean igual a blancos
Set rela to codigo Into clientes

bueno si estimas escribemé..
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:Relacion entre tablas

Publicado por jesus (405 intervenciones) el 18/09/2006 23:23:08
prueba la opcion "Filter" que exluye registros que no cumplan con una condicion.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ar